Seller Readiness Checklist Before You Interview Agents

Start with clarity so you can compare like-for-like when speaking with local professionals. Gather property details, recent bills and documentation, and a clear list of upgrades, maintenance history, and any repairs planned. Decide your selling priorities—price, speed, certainty, or flexibility on viewings—then confirm your budget range for marketing estate agents galway for sellers and fees. Prepare answers for common questions about condition, planning considerations, service charge issues (if relevant), and any prior sale attempts. Having this information ready helps build accurate pricing advice and a realistic marketing plan.

Marketing & Valuation Checklist to Validate the Strategy

Ask for a written valuation approach and a marketing proposal rather than relying on a single number. Confirm the recommended price band, the evidence used (comparable sales and active listings), and the rationale behind any pricing strategy. Request details on photography, floor plan inclusion, online listing distribution, signage, and open-house planning. Check how they handle leads, respond to enquiries, and qualify buyers to protect auctioneers Galway your privacy and reduce wasted viewings. Ensure they explain how they position your home against similar properties and what actions they take if offers don’t arrive as expected. Fees, Terms, and Negotiation Checklist for Confident Decisions

Review the full fee structure before you sign anything. Confirm whether fees are fixed or percentage-based, what is included (marketing, photography, floor plans, legal coordination, viewings), and any additional charges that may arise. Understand the term length of the agreement, what happens if you switch agents, and how your listing is handled during any notice period. Ask how offers are presented, who negotiates, and how they advise on counteroffers and buyer credibility checks. Clarify what reporting you receive—feedback frequency, lead statistics, and offer updates—so you stay in control. For sellers who want strong outcomes, make sure they demonstrate a negotiation process designed to protect both price and certainty.
